Hair and Make-Up Artist Uzmee Krakovzski and Fashion Stylist Tiffani Rae Lend a Helping Hand for the Cover of Batanga Magazine Featuring Actor Rick Gonzalez

   

01_2141_01                            
    Crystal Agency hair and make-up artist Uzmee Krakovszki and fashion stylist Tiffani Rae were booked with photographer, Tatiana Botton, to shoot the cover of Batanga Magazine featuring actor Rick Gonzalez, who just wrapped up shooting the movie “Pride and Glory” with Colin Farrell and Edward Norton, due out in 2009.
    Rick Gonzalez has a street casual style, and the photographer wanted him to maintain his rough, and gritty look. To fulfill the photographer’s expectations, celebrity stylist Tiffani Rae chose a color palette of dark greens, deep purples, golds, and reds, and then grabbed shoes from Reebok’s new 2008 line, which she described as being “incredibly versatile”.
    Look for Tiffani and Uzmee’s bio on the contributor’s page of the March 2008 issue of Batanga Magazine. Congrats girls!
